How to Schedule Tesla Service During Peak Seasons Without Delays

Scheduling Tesla service during peak seasons can be challenging due to increased demand. However, with proper planning and strategies, you can avoid delays and ensure your vehicle receives timely maintenance.

Understanding Peak Seasons

Peak seasons typically include holidays, summer months, and end-of-year periods when many Tesla owners seek service. During these times, service centers often experience higher volume, leading to longer wait times.

Strategies to Schedule Tesla Service Effectively

  • Plan Ahead: Book your service appointment well in advance, preferably several weeks before the peak season begins.
  • Use Tesla’s Online Scheduler: Utilize the Tesla app or website to check availability and reserve your spot early.
  • Opt for Off-Peak Hours: Schedule appointments during early mornings or late afternoons when demand is lower.
  • Stay Flexible: Be willing to adjust your preferred dates to secure an earlier appointment.
  • Contact Service Centers Directly: Sometimes, calling the service center can yield better scheduling options than online booking.
